Abstract
The utility model provides a kind of kiln desulfurization and dedusting cooling system, including integral box, circulating water pool, lye pond and purification tank for liquid waste, the purification tank for liquid waste and the lye pond are connect with the circulating water pool respectively, it is provided with spray section in the integral box, cascade section and cooling section, the first air inlet pipe and the second air inlet pipe are connected at the top of the spray section, the inside of the spray section is filled with filler, the bottom of the spray section is provided with the first collecting tank, multiple spray heads are provided at the top of the spray section, the top of the cascade section, which is arranged side by side, multiple rows of cascade nozzle, the bottom of the cascade section is provided with the second collecting tank, the cascade section is connected to the cooling section, the first spiral cooling water pipe is surrounded in the cooling section, the cooling section is connected with chimney, sulfurous gas detection device is provided in the chimney.The utility model aims to solve the problem that the high and not transferable problem of existing desulfurizing tower construction cost.

Background technology
In the production process of ceramic tile, need to there is a sintering procedure, wherein roller kilns in firing process with water-gas or natural gas
For fuel, water-gas by being generated by the gas generator of fuel of coal, through dedusting, desulfurization, catch the cleaning procedures such as tar after it is pure
Water purification coal gas, which is supplied by pipeline to roller kilns, to burn, and the tail gas after burning is by 22m chimney high altitude discharges.It is more in order to reduce energy consumption
It is fuel with natural gas, existing exhaust gas source is mainly that roller kilns generate a certain amount of pollutant in firing and process for preparation, production
It is mainly the relatively large amount of harmful components such as SO2, NOx and particulate matter in object, affects production environment.Existing desulfurizer is frequently with desulfurization
Tower is realized, however the construction cost of desulfurizing tower is high, while having not transferability, is only applicable to large-scale desulphurization system, application
Resource consumption, excess capacity are caused in natural gas vent gas treatment.

Shown in Figure 1, the utility model provides a kind of kiln desulfurization and dedusting cooling system, including integral box 16, follows
Ring pond 1, lye pond 3 and purification tank for liquid waste 2, the purification tank for liquid waste 2 and the lye pond 3 respectively with the circulating water pool 1
It connects, is provided with spray section 23, cascade section 19 and cooling section 17 in the integral box 16, the top of the spray section 23 is connected with
The inside of first air inlet pipe 6 and the second air inlet pipe 5, the spray section 23 is filled with filler, and the bottom of the spray section 23 is arranged
There are the first collecting tank 21, the top of the spray section 23 to be provided with multiple spray heads 7, multiple spray heads 7 and the cycle
It is provided with the connection of first pipe 4 between pond 1, the second pipe is provided between first collecting tank 21 and the circulating water pool 1
Road 22 connects, and the spray section 23 is connected to the cascade section 19, and the top of the cascade section 19, which is arranged side by side, multiple rows of cascade
The bottom of nozzle 11, the cascade section 19 is provided with the second collecting tank 18, multiple rows of cascade nozzle 19 and the circulating water pool 1
Between be provided with third pipeline 8 connection, be provided between second collecting tank 18 and the circulating water pool 1 the 4th pipeline 20 company
It connects, the cascade section 19 is connected to the cooling section 17, and the first spiral cooling water pipe 15, institute are surrounded in the cooling section 17
It states cooling section 17 and is connected with chimney 13, sulfurous gas detection device 14 is provided in the chimney 13.
The second spiral cooling water pipe 12 is surrounded in the chimney 13.
The integral box 16 is stainless steel babinet, double-layer ceramic tile is pasted on the inner wall of the integral box 16, for preventing
Integral box 16 is corroded by sulphur-containing substance.
Further include having return duct 9, the return duct 9 is separately connected second air inlet pipe 5 and cooling section 17, the reflux
Wind turbine 10 is provided on pipe 9, it is when the sulfurous gas detection device 14 detection sulfurous gas is exceeded, then right by return duct 9
Exhaust gas carries out after-treatment.
This kiln desulfurization and dedusting cooling system uses integral box as main exhaust gas processing device, only need to additionally be arranged
Circulating water pool, lye pond and purification tank for liquid waste can form the desulfurization and dedusting cooling system of exhaust gas, have higher transferability,
When carrying out exhaust-gas treatment, lye can be added into circulating water pool by lye pond, then the lye in lye pond is passed through into the spray
Leaching head forms spraying effect in the spray section of the integral box, can effectively remove sulfurous gas and dust in exhaust gas, then
Lye is back in circulating water pool by the first collecting tank and is recycled, the cascade section is for eliminating remaining sour gas
Body discharges after being cooled down to exhaust gas finally by the first spiral cooling water pipe in cooling section, realizes desulfurization, dedusting and drop
Temperature function.
